Constellium has expanded its partnership with Audi to supply advanced aluminium solutions for the Audi e-tron GT. Constellium provides ASI-certified aluminium Auto Body Sheet solutions for closures and inner parts and extrusion-based components for the vehicle’s front and rear Crash Management Systems.

Constellium’s Surfalex® Auto Body Sheet solution is used for the rear doors and fenders of the Audi e-tron GT. It allows bold styling while maintaining perfect surface aesthetics. Constellium’s Securalex® solution, used for the hood inner, has a high-tech crash absorption capacity designed to fulfill the most demanding pedestrian safety requirements. Constellium supplied its products from it’s plant in Neuf-Brisach, France.
Constellium HSA6™ is an aextrusion alloys used on the vehicle’s Crash Management Systems .It provides additional strength in the event of a creash. The Crash Management Systems are produced at Constellium’s ASI-certified plant in Gottmadingen, Germany.
Constellium's aluminium products are also delivered for Audi’s first fully-electric model, the Audi e-tron SUV, along with extruded components for the e-tron’s battery enclosure and side impact beams. Aluminium extruded components make up the structure of the Audi e-tron battery enclosure.
